ROBERT LANAGHAN is a writer. Or, at least, he was, but, since his second book was published, he hasn’t written. Life has got in the way.

There was his passionate affair with Siobhan McGovern, a famous, if rather whacky, singer. She turned up at his book launch, fell for him, and lives with him, having become pregnant.

She hops off on tour, leaving Robert to care for their baby, Ciara, and, on her return, ceremoniously dumps him. Accepting an astronomical sum of money in return for a promise that he will never see his daughter again, Robert leaves, and spends his time travelling aimlessly around Europe to escape himself.
